Connecticut Statutes
§ 10a-80e — Immunity for donation of tangible property to a regional community-technical college.
Any person, as defined in section 1-79, who donates tangible property to a regional community-technical college shall be immune from civil liability for damage or injury occurring on or after October 1, 2013, resulting from any act, error or omission by such person with respect to such donated tangible property, unless such damage or injury was caused by the reckless, wilful or wanton misconduct of such person.

Legislative History
(P.A. 13-261, S. 9.)
